运维

运维

Products

当前位置:首页 > 运维 >

如何巧妙配置Ubuntu MongoDB,提升性能?

96SEO 2025-05-14 07:46 4


MongoDB数据库性能优化指南

数据库性能是柔软件系统稳稳当当运行的关键因素, 特别是在用MongoDB这类高大性能、可 的文档存储系统时。本文将深厚入探讨怎么在Ubuntu系统上安装、配置和优化MongoDB,帮您提升数据库性能。

一、 MongoDB简介

MongoDB是一款基于文档的NoSQL数据库,以JSON格式存储数据,具有高大可 性和灵活性。它适用于巨大数据应用, 具有以下特点: - 无模式设计,便于数据模型变更; - 支持许多种数据类型,如字符串、数字、日期等; - 支持索引、查询、聚合等操作。

Ubuntu MongoDB配置有哪些技巧

二、 MongoDB在Ubuntu系统上的安装与配置

  1. 下载MongoDB安装包访问MongoDB官网,选择适合Linux系统的版本进行下载。
  2. 创建配置文件夹和配置文件运行以下命令: bash tar -zxvf mongodb-linux-x86_64-4.0.13.tgz -C /usr/local/mongoDB
  3. 配置MongoDB创建配置文件mongodb.conf, 内容如下: yaml net: maxIncomingConnections: 2000 storage: wiredTiger: engineConfig: cacheSizeGB: 4
  4. 启动MongoDB服务运行以下命令: bash sudo systemctl start mongod sudo systemctl status mongod

三、性能优化策略

  1. 创建索引为三天两头用于查询的字段创建索引,以搞优良查询性能。
  2. 监控数据库性能用MongoDB自带的工具mongostatmongotop监控数据库性能。
  3. 平安配置启用身份验证,设置材料管束,并确保MongoDB服务运行在平安的端口上。
  4. 优化配置文件调整缓存巨大细小、连接数等参数,以满足实际需求。

四、 实际案例与数据支撑

  • 案例某电商平台用MongoDB存储用户数据,查询性能较差。
  • 优化策略为常用字段创建索引,调整缓存巨大细小为8GB。
  • 效果查询性能提升了40%,响应时候缩短暂了50%。

五、与觉得能

通过以上优化策略,您能显著提升MongoDB数据库的性能。在实际应用中,请,并建立持续的性能监控体系,确保系统始终保持最优状态。


标签: ubuntu

提交需求或反馈

Demand feedback